Summary/Abstract: Author gives the information about musical instrument, which was found in the Cave of Altai Mountain. He have been investigating this instrument and came to that this instrument is “Dombra (musical instrument of Kazakh people)”. On the neck of this instrument was runic inscription, author entered the sentence, which was read by him, in the scientific turn. The sentence gives the following meaning: “The fragrant melody gives the pleasure us”. Analyzing the peculiarities of this runic inscription author made conclusion that this instrument is concerned to 5th-7th century. The appearance of term “kui” proves that this instrument is the heritage of Sak’s (Scyth) period. Thus, author concludes: there is a possibility of that this instrument, which was found in Altai mountain, is one of the primary examples of the string instruments.
